Summary
Teaching Drama: Skills, games and playbuilding provides entry points for the beginner and advanced practitioner in schools and communities.
The book includes: • Practical exercises and techniques, approaches and starting points in an easy-to-read format. • Emphasis on effective playbuilding skills. • Outlines the development of playbuilding from introductory exercises through to advanced practices. • Provides examples of units of work. • Includes application within mime, mas…

About The Author
Lesley Christen
LESLEY CHRISTEN taught high school drama for over 40 years in Australia, Britain and Singapore. She has a Bachelor of Educational Studies (Newcastle University); a Dip. Ed.-majoring in Drama-(Melbourne University), an M.A. Theatre & Film Studies (UNSW) and completed courses in Drama/Documentary Script Writing and Video Production at the AFTRS. She has facilitated many workshops both in Australia and internationally and has been an HSC marker. Her previous book was Drama Skills for Life: A handbook for teachers.
